Local Recruiter Named Ninth Best in Nationwide College Sports

Jay Clark, Georgia's head gymnastics coach, was just named the ninth best recruiter in college sports. The ranking came from ESPNU and ESPN magazine. The list compiled a top 20 of who's who in college sports recruiting. Experts examined candidates before coming up with their final top 20, where Jay Clark was listed.
